Evaluate and clean the spray arms to ensure they are not blocked
To check and cleanse the spray arms of your dishwasher, start by finding them in the dishwashing machine's inside. The spray arms are in charge of distributing water and detergent to all dishes, so it is important to guarantee they are not blocked. Meticulously examine the spray arms for any food particles, mineral buildup, or debris that could be blocking the water flow. Utilize a brush or toothpick to remove any type of obstructions and wash the spray arms extensively under running water to remove any residue. This maintenance step can help improve the dishwashing machine's cleaning performance and avoid prospective problems in the future.

If you discover consistent obstructions or the spray arms continue to underperform even after cleaning, it may be necessary to seek professional help. Use the proper quantity of detergent according to the dishwasher's guidebook
Among the most common blunders that individuals make when using their Amana dish washer is not making use of the appropriate amount of cleaning agent. Utilizing too little cleaning agent can cause meals not being cleaned effectively, while utilizing too much can bring about residue being left behind on your recipes. To guarantee optimal cleansing performance, it is essential to comply with the guidelines outlined in the dish washer's handbook regarding the advised amount of cleaning agent to utilize for each laundry cycle.

Proper cleaning agent usage is vital to accomplishing sparkling tidy dishes whenever. Failure to make use of the appropriate quantity of detergent can influence the dishwashing machine's performance and lead to poor cleaning outcomes. By thoroughly gauging and using the ideal amount of cleaning agent as specified in the handbook, you can aid your dishwashing machine feature at its best and make certain that your dishes appear pristine after each cycle.

Examine the water inlet valve for any kind of blockages or breakdowns
One of the usual reasons why a dish washer may fall short to clean recipes effectively is because of clogs or malfunctions in the water inlet shutoff. The water inlet valve is accountable for allowing water to go into the dish washer during the cleansing cycle. If it is clogged or otherwise operating correctly, it can cause low water stress, preventing the dishwashing machine's capacity to clean meals extensively. To address this problem, it is vital to examine the water inlet shutoff for any obstructions or breakdowns that might be impacting its efficiency

In many cases, an easy cleansing of the water inlet shutoff can deal with the problem and boost the dishwasher's cleaning capacities. Nonetheless, if the valve is damaged or defective, it might require replacement to make sure the correct flow of water into the dishwashing machine throughout operation. Make sure the dish washer is loaded properly to permit water and detergent to get to all recipes
Incorrect loading of the dish washer can lead to bad cleansing results. To guarantee water and cleaning agent reach all meals successfully, avoid overcrowding the shelfs with way too many items. Enable correct spacing between dishes, mugs, and Amana Repair Service tools to allow the water spray to reach all surfaces. In addition, make sure that dishes are not blocking the spray arms or blocking the cleaning agent dispenser from opening correctly throughout the clean cycle.

Correct arrangement of meals is crucial to an effective dishwasher cycle. Place larger products such as pots and frying pans under shelf facing down to allow the water spray to reach their interiors. Likewise, make sure that smaller sized things like mugs and glasses are securely positioned on the top rack to avoid them from moving and not obtaining correct cleansing.
